A: We cannot process felt, velvet or fur shoes. And we cannot process knitted, crocheted, lace-trimmed, terry shoes or slippers. These loose or soft materials simply don't hold their shape well during plating and tend to become stretched or misshapen.
A: These now make up a large portion of our business and they look terrific! The antique bronze finish looks and processes best on these shoes.
A: Yes. However, due to the material christening slippers are made of, occasionally when they are bronzed, they can appear somewhat stretched out. Also, on these slippers with frilly lace, the lace must be pressed down against the body of the slippers and may not be completely uniform around the slippers. Due to these issues, christening slippers cannot be covered under our Satisfaction Guarantee.
A: Baby shoe bronzing takes 6-8 weeks. Bronzing other items takes 10-12 weeks. Be sure to add time for shipping each way. We ship most orders back by insured UPS.

A: Yes. We close our factory for 2 weeks each summer (usually the last week of June and first week of July) for employee vacations. We also close each year around December 17 until January 6 for our holiday shutdown. So please note these dates...as if you send an order in any time before these, the turnaround time for your bronzing will be delayed while we're closed.
A: Yes. We can make the finish look beautiful but we cannot reshape them. Use the same pricing as for a new bronzing order.
A: No. The shoes do NOT have to match. Any 2 shoes in the size range will be priced as listed. Please note "mismatched shoes" when you send them in for bronzing.
A: Just wipe them occasionally with a soft dry cloth. Never use polish or cleaners which will cut through the protective lacquer coating that preserves the finish.
A: Sorry, but we must tie the laces on all shoes so they won't break off during processing. All shoes are tied the same way where the bows lie to the sides of the shoes.
A: Since most buttons are so old, we cannot replace them. But for missing shoe laces, we will automatically replace them.
A: Yes...but they MUST be accompanied with a note stating "Leave shoes with no laces." Otherwise, if shoes are sent in without laces, we will automatically add laces to them before bronzing.
